Starting 2027-2028, large shippers will screen their carriers under the EU CSDDD directive (2024/1760 + Omnibus I 2026/470). Carriers that can deliver wellbeing evidence stay on the shortlist. TruckerVerse is not a fleet tool and not a control layer, it is the evidence infrastructure you don't have yet, and the wellbeing investment that translates into audit-ready by 2029.
Aggregated, k-anonymous, audit-grade driver-wellbeing evidence, downstream-chain due diligence required from July 2029 for in-scope companies (>5,000 employees + >€1.5B turnover). We deliver the part about your drivers.
